Yes, the Level 3 Certificate in Assessing Vocational Achievement course does involve practical assessments as part of the learning process. Practical assessments are a crucial component of this course as they allow students to demonstrate their understanding and application of assessment principles in a real-world vocational setting.
During the course, students will be required to complete a series of practical assessments that will assess their ability to plan, carry out, and evaluate assessments in a vocational setting. These assessments may include observing and assessing learners in a workplace, conducting interviews with learners and colleagues, and providing feedback on assessment decisions.
By engaging in practical assessments, students will develop the necessary skills and knowledge to effectively assess vocational achievement in a variety of settings. These assessments are designed to be hands-on and interactive, allowing students to apply their learning in a practical and meaningful way.
